What you will be doing

JOB DESCRIPTION

Overview

The Administrative Coordinator will provide high-level, comprehensive support to Drs. Peter Fabricant and David Scher in their capacity as Associate Program Directors for the Orthopedic Residency program. The role manages their day-to-day schedules, organizing and preparing for meetings, and acting as the point of contact among executives, employees, clients, and other external partners. The position also assists with strategic planning of programs and initiatives, coordinating meetings and retreats, and preparing correspondence and letters on behalf of Drs. Fabricant and Scher. Additionally, the position supports the physicians with special projects and initiatives.

In this role, the applicant must exhibit the ability to transcribe material of a highly confidential nature, as well as compose letters and initiate correspondence for review by Executives. Additionally, promoting a professional atmosphere through courteous communication, cooperation, and respect for patients, visitors, colleagues, and members of the health care team is essential.

Responsibilities:

  • Administrative responsibilities may include:
  • Act as the point of contact among executives, employees, and other external partners
  • Manage calendars and coordinate meetings
  • Manage information flow in a timely and accurate manner
  • Organize travel and accommodations for business trips/offsite conferences
  • Prepare and submit travel-related expenses following each business trip or offsite conference/meeting and keeping record of paid/unpaid reimbursements
  • Assist in planning of academic programs and activities for the residency
  • Regularly attend and participate in meetings between Drs. Fabricant and Scher and members of the Academic Training Staff, facilitating follow up on action items
  • Adeptly handle administrative matters including screening calls, managing calendars, planning meetings, making travel arrangements, processing reimbursements, check requests, and invoice payments
  • Interact professionally with all levels of staff and maintain the highest level of confidentiality maintaining tact and diplomacy in handling sensitive issues
  • Collaborate, participate, and lead strategic initiatives and projects at the direction of Drs. Scher and Fabricant
  • Help support the planning and coordination of Pediatric rotation of the Orthopedic Residency under the leadership of the Pediatric Education Director including assistance with scheduling, coordination and other education related activities
  • Collaborate and work with Physician's clinical office staff to ensure schedule alignment.
